As nouns, Solanum melongena and aubergine are synonyms defined as:
  • Solanum melongena and aubergine: hairy upright herb native to southeastern Asia but widely cultivated for its large glossy edible fruit commonly used as a vegetable
Other synonyms of Solanum melongena include brinjal, eggplant, eggplant bush, garden egg, mad apple.
